# Can Peptides Make You Break Out: A Personal Perspective on Skincare Reactions
When I first integrated synthetic signaling molecules into my routine, I was chasing the promise of firmer, more resilient skin. Like many enthusiasts, I had heard that these amino acid chains were the "gold standard" for structural support. However, after a few weeks, I found myself questioning: can peptides make you break out? My journey through various formulations taught me that the answer is rarely black and white; it often involves distinguishing between true acne and temporary skin reactivity.
Peptides are essential amino acid chains that function as signaling molecules. They tell your body to perform specific tasks, such as stimulating collagen production or increasing skin elasticity. Because they are generally non-comedogenic, pure peptide serums rarely clog pores. Troubleshooting the "Peptide Purge"
One common question I have encountered is: *do peptides cause skin purging*? While active ingredients like retinoids are known to cause a purge by speeding up cell turnover, peptides generally do not have this effect. If you notice a flare-up, it is more likely one of the following:
1. Formulation Sensitivity: Some copper peptide brands, such as GHK-Cu, are highly potent. Their active nature can sometimes cause a sensory reaction on sensitive skin, which might be mistaken for an acne breakout.
2. Barrier Compromise: If your moisture barrier is already stressed, introducing a new, potent serum can lead to irritation and redness.
